Door Installation in Pompano Beach Highlands - Timeline, Process, and What You’ll Pay

Most door installation projects in Pompano Beach Highlands take one to three days, depending on whether we’re fitting a standard prehung unit into existing framing or cutting a new opening into concrete block stucco. A straightforward replacement runs $800-$2,800 per door, including labor and mid-grade hardware, while new openings or impact-rated upgrades push higher. How We Handle Door Installation - Start to Finish

We’ve installed doors in enough Pompano Beach Highlands homes to know where the surprises hide. Here’s what actually happens, and when you’ll need to make decisions.

Stage 1: Site measure and condition check - 30-60 minutes

We arrive, photograph the existing opening, and check three things that determine everything downstream: whether the concrete block framing is plumb and square, what the interior wall finish is (stucco, drywall, or old plaster), and whether the existing door was originally installed with proper flashing above the header. In 1960s CBS homes here, we often find the original aluminum jamb rotted at the sill or the header unflashed, which adds half a day of remedial work. You’ll decide at this stage: standard replacement or impact-rated upgrade, and whether you want the interior trim replaced or reused.

Stage 2: Product finalization and permit pull - 3-10 business days

We lock in your door unit, hardware, and finish. If you’re in unincorporated Broward County rather than the City of Pompano Beach, we file through the county’s separate permitting portal - a scheduling reality that adds a few days compared to neighboring Lighthouse Point jobs. You’ll approve the final shop drawings here. We handle the permit; you don’t visit the building department.

Stage 3: Demo and rough opening prep - 2-6 hours

We remove the old unit, inspect the concrete block for spalling or moisture intrusion, and cut the opening to spec. If we’re widening the opening, we install a steel or laminated wood header rated for the load above - critical in these single-story CBS homes with their flat roof structures. This is where we discover whether the original builder used proper tie-downs; sometimes we find corroded straps that need replacement to satisfy current wind-mitigation inspections.

Stage 4: Door unit install and weather sealing - 3-5 hours

The prehung unit goes in level and plumb, shimmed to the block, then anchored with Tapcon-style masonry fasteners or epoxy-set threaded rod depending on the wind-load rating required. We apply a fluid-applied flashing membrane at the sill and head - non-negotiable in Pompano Beach Highlands given the 60+ inches of annual rainfall and the flat terrain that traps water against foundations. Then foam, trim, and hardware.

Stage 5: Final inspection and touch - 30-45 minutes

We test operation, check lockset alignment, verify the sweep contacts the threshold evenly, and walk you through maintenance - particularly important for fiberglass and steel units where the salt air from the Atlantic, barely a mile east, attacks exposed hardware. You’ll sign off, we file the certificate of completion, and your permit gets closed.

The Door Options You’ll Actually Choose Between

Door installation in Pompano Beach Highlands isn’t one-size-fits-all. The right unit depends on your home’s code requirements, your insurance situation, and how much maintenance you’re willing to do.

  • Fiberglass entry doors: The practical default for most CBS homes here. Resists denting and warping, takes paint well, and won’t rust in the salt air. Mid-range units run $400-$1,200 for the slab; premium architectural lines with decorative glass push $2,000+. The honest trade-off: fiberglass can fade in direct south exposure after 8-10 years, and the skin can delaminate if water gets behind poor flashing.
  • Steel entry doors: Stronger security, lower price point ($300-$900 for standard slabs), but the salt environment is unforgiving. We only specify steel with factory-applied baked enamel or vinyl coating; raw or primed steel edges will rust through in 3-4 years within a mile of the ocean. Best for covered entries with minimal direct weather exposure.
  • Impact-rated doors (fiberglass or aluminum): Required for new openings or substantial renovations under the Florida Building Code’s 25% rule, and increasingly necessary for homeowners facing non-renewal from insurers writing in Broward County. These units carry Miami-Dade or Florida Product Approval numbers, include laminated glass, and add $800-$2,500 per opening over standard construction. The hardware is heftier, the frames deeper, and the installation more exacting - but they’re the only path to a wind-mitigation discount on many older policies.
  • Solid wood doors: Available in mahogany, fir, and oak species. Beautiful, heavy, and repairable - a scratched solid wood door can be sanded and refinished where fiberglass or steel must be replaced. The catch: they swell and bind in humid months unless finished meticulously on all six sides, and they’re not available in impact-rated configurations. We recommend them only for interior applications or fully protected exterior entries in Pompano Beach Highlands.
  • Sliding and French patio doors: A separate category with their own page, but worth noting here: many homeowners doing entry door work simultaneously discover their 1970s aluminum sliding patio door is corroded at the track and no longer weather-tight. What Door Installation Costs in Pompano Beach Highlands, FL

Scope Typical Range
Standard prehung replacement (existing opening, fiberglass or steel) $800 - $2,800
Impact-rated prehung replacement $1,600 - $4,500
New cut-in opening (block wall, standard door) $2,200 - $5,500
New cut-in opening (block wall, impact-rated) $3,500 - $7,500
Double-door unit (fiberglass, standard) $1,800 - $4,200
Hardware upgrade (multipoint lock, premium handle set) $200 - $800

Five variables move your number within these ranges. First, existing condition: a rotted sill, corroded fasteners, or moisture-damaged block adds $400-$1,200 in remediation before the new unit goes in. Second, incorporation status: unincorporated Broward County parcels require county permits with their own fee schedule and inspection timeline, versus city permits for addresses within Pompano Beach proper. Third, material grade: a builder-grade fiberglass slab with basic hardware versus a architectural-line unit with transom glass and a multipoint lockset can triple the material cost. Fourth, structural modification: widening an opening in CBS construction means cutting block, installing a new header, and potentially relocating electrical - we find original wiring run through door headers in about 30% of 1960s homes here. Fifth, wind-mitigation triggers: if your project triggers the 25% rule, the door must be impact-rated and tied into the home’s structural envelope, adding engineering review and inspection rounds.

Our written estimates include the door unit, all labor, rough opening prep, standard hardware, weather sealing, trim (interior and exterior), permit fees, and final inspection coordination. What’s typically separate: decorative glass upgrades, smart lock hardware, exterior painting or stucco repair beyond the immediate opening, and any electrical or plumbing relocation.

What Pompano Beach Highlands Homes Specifically Do to This Job

The housing stock here shapes every door installation we perform. These 1960s-1970s concrete block stucco homes were built before Florida’s modern hurricane code, and the combination of aging materials, salt corrosion, and insurance-driven retrofit requirements creates a project profile you won’t find in newer inland communities.

We regularly work on streets like NE 3rd Avenue and the blocks around Hammondville Road, where the original aluminum jamb doors have corroded at the threshold and the surrounding block has spalled from decades of rainwater pooling against flat slabs with inadequate drainage. The salt-laden air from the Atlantic, roughly a mile east, accelerates corrosion of exposed fasteners and flashing - we’ve pulled original installation screws from 1972 that were reduced to rust dust. That environment is why we specify stainless steel or hot-dip galvanized fasteners for all exterior hardware, and why we won’t install an uncoated steel door on any Pompano Beach Highlands home without full overhead protection.

The permitting reality is equally specific. Depending on your parcel, you may fall under unincorporated Broward County or the City of Pompano Beach - two separate building departments with different inspection schedules and, occasionally, differing interpretations of the Florida Building Code’s 25% rule. We’ve navigated both enough to know which addresses trigger which pathway, and we file accordingly. For homeowners already facing insurance non-renewal, we coordinate the wind-mitigation inspection documentation so your new impact-rated door counts toward the hardening credits your carrier requires.
